As Google’s head of brand accessibility, KR Liu is as influential a voice for the disabled community as you’ll find on the corporate carpet. Her injunction to marketers—the time has come to get serious about inclusion—won global attention last year with Google’s release of its Accessible Marketing Playbook, a seminal document that Liu had a big hand in creating. More than two years in the making, the playbook is a comprehensive how-to manual for marketers looking to reach historically marginalized groups, including plus-size consumers, the LGBTQ+ community and people with disabilities.
